Unemployed health insurance coverage rates in Lee County, Mississippi compared
How does Lee County, Mississippi compare to other Mississippi and National averages?
Lee County, Mississippi
69.4%
Mississippi
59.1% (-15% lower than Lee County, Mississippi)
National average
76.6% (10% higher than Lee County, Mississippi)
